Job description

Job Details: Fresno County - Fresno, CA 93720 | Position Type: Part Time | Education Level: 2 Year Degree | Salary Range: $25.00 - $25.00 Hourly | Job Shift: 1:00PM - 6:00PM | Job Category: Education | Cities served: This application is for CENTRAL UNIFIED SCHOOL DISTRICT ONLY

As an Assistant Site Lead, you will work closely with the Site Lead to supervise an afterschool program, support staff and students, and ensure all activities align with program goals and safety standards. Your role involves data entry, reporting, leading activities, and bridging the gap between administration and the classroom.

Responsibilities
  • Assist with Coordination of Designated Afterschool Program Site: support the Site Lead in coordinating program activities, collect and prepare program data for review, maintain a safe and healthy learning environment, oversee enrichment and instructional materials, keep classrooms clean, assist with placement of students and staff, train participants on attendance and participation, communicate with students, parents and external agencies, monitor student behavior, enforce behavioral standards and communicate conduct issues to parents and school personnel.
  • Assist with Marketing Program: develop a unique and marketable name for the site; design and develop marketing materials such as flyers, brochures and posters; create and implement incentive programs; disseminate enrollment applications; increase enrollment through creative marketing and advertising within budget; input attendance data into approved CTFF software; maintain records and reports required by State and Federal agencies; monitor and record student activities.
  • Monitor and Observe Classroom: visit classrooms daily to ensure staff engagement, coach and mentor staff, provide flexibility for instructional and enrichment time, observe home and enrichment time, give constructive feedback, review lesson plans, assist in monitoring student placement, address student behavioral and conduct issues professionally.
  • Tutor, Monitor, and Mentor Student Learning: engage in general tutoring duties with CTFF guidelines, tutor individually and in groups, prepare or follow lesson plans, ensure educational objectives are met, submit lesson plans to Teaching Fellows, prepare reports on activities and accomplishments, enforce rules for good behavior, observe and evaluate student performance and well‑being, monitor use of equipment and materials.
  • Perform Other Duties as Assigned: temporarily assume Site Lead duties in absence, attend staff development trainings, provide opinions and suggestions on program decisions, maintain a visible presence, and complete any other duties assigned.
Qualifications & Minimum Requirements
  • 18 years old or older.
  • High school diploma or GED equivalent.
  • Authorization to work in the United States.
  • Completion of 48 college units or suitable exam to meet NCLB requirements.
  • Availability to work 1:00PM - 6:00PM, Monday through Friday.
  • Proficiency in English, including spelling, grammar, and composition.
  • General understanding of educational standards and the public school system.
  • Willingness to undergo background checks and a Tuberculosis exam.
  • One year of prior management experience or 6 months as a Teaching Fellow.
Preferred Qualifications
  • 1-2 years of college education with an emphasis in education.
  • Strong commitment to community service and youth development.
  • Understanding of the public school system and state educational standards.
  • Exceptional written, verbal, and interpersonal communication skills.
  • Ability to lead and motivate groups and individuals.
  • Strong leadership and organizational skills.
  • Basic understanding of marketing and advertising.
  • Proficiency in Google Suite (Docs, Sheets, Slides).
  • Basic understanding of human resources and budget management.
Benefits of Becoming an Assistant Site Lead
  • Weekends off (excluding one Saturday per month for paid professional development).
  • Personal and Professional Development.
  • Scholarship opportunities for those interested in pursuing a career in education.
  • Sick Pay.
  • Transferability across the six counties served by CTFF.
